Weather Exposure and Auto Body Repair Risks in Little Rock
Vehicles in Little Rock, Arkansas, are exposed year-round to weather patterns that lead to fading, corrosion, and surface dents. From UV damage in the summer to rust formation during rainy and humid seasons, the need for preventive care and timely repair is critical.
Hot summers can cause the paint to expand and contract. This leads to surface cracks in the paint. Rainwater and standing moisture settle in hidden parts of the vehicle, such as seams and wheel wells, making them prone to rust. Hail and windstorms contribute to paint chips and dents. This damage can worsen over time, leading to more expensive repairs and a shorter vehicle lifespan.
Common Paint and Surface Issues Caused by Arkansas Weather
Fading and UV Breakdown
Long-term exposure to the sun breaks down the protective clear coat on vehicles, especially those parked outdoors. This leads to fading, chalkiness, and loss of shine, particularly on flat surfaces like the hood and roof. Regular cleaning and protective coatings from a trusted auto body shop can slow down this process.
Moisture-Driven Corrosion
Little Rock’s high humidity increases the risk of rust forming in hard-to-reach areas. Moisture seeps into door seams, undercarriage parts, and rocker panels, triggering oxidation on exposed metal. Even minimal contact with road salt during winter ice events can speed up corrosion in the lower parts of the vehicle.
Damage from Hail and Debris
During storm season, flying debris and hailstones can leave behind dents, scratches, and paint damage. These issues often go unnoticed until the vehicle is inspected closely by a qualified car body shop. If left untreated, the exposed areas become vulnerable to further weather-related damage.
